If anyone has any objections, please let me know. ------------------ From: Qianfeng Rong [ Upstream commit 4ef353d546cda466fc39b7daca558d7bcec21c09 ] Change the 'ret' variable from u16 to int to store negative error codes or zero returned by lx_message_send_atomic(). Storing the negative error codes in unsigned type, doesn't cause an issue at runtime but it's ugly as pants. Additionally, assigning negative error codes to unsigned type may trigger a GCC warning when the -Wsign-conversion flag is enabled. No effect on runtime.
